A Professional Guide to CRM Software Comparison and Review
Selecting the right Customer Relationship Management (CRM) software is a critical decision that can significantly impact sales productivity, customer satisfaction, and overall business growth. A structured, technical approach is essential to navigate the crowded market and choose a solution that aligns with your specific organizational needs. This guide provides a comprehensive framework for conducting a professional CRM comparison review.
1. Define Core Business Requirements
Before evaluating any software, you must first document your internal requirements. This foundational step ensures your comparison is based on concrete needs rather than generic features. A comprehensive requirements analysis is the single most important factor in a successful CRM implementation.
- Stakeholder Identification: Involve key personnel from Sales, Marketing, Customer Service, and IT to gather diverse perspectives and ensure buy-in.
- Process Mapping: Document your current sales, marketing, and service workflows. Identify existing pain points, bottlenecks, and inefficiencies that a CRM should solve.
- Objective Setting: Establish specific, measurable, achievable, relevant, and time-bound (SMART) goals. For example, "Reduce average lead response time by 30% within six months" or "Increase customer retention by 15% in one year."
- Budgeting: Define a clear budget for the Total Cost of Ownership (TCO), which includes subscription fees, implementation, data migration, training, and ongoing support.
2. Core Feature and Functionality Analysis
Once requirements are defined, create a feature checklist to evaluate potential CRM platforms. Prioritize these features as "must-have," "nice-to-have," or "not applicable" to your business.
- Contact & Lead Management: Assess the system's ability to store, track, and manage customer and lead information, including communication history and activity logs.
- Sales Pipeline Management: The CRM must offer a clear, customizable view of the sales pipeline (e.g., Kanban boards), allowing for easy tracking of opportunities through various stages.
- Automation Capabilities: Evaluate workflow automation for tasks like lead assignment, follow-up reminders, and email sequences. Look at marketing automation features such as campaign management and lead scoring.
- Reporting & Analytics: The platform should provide robust reporting tools with customizable dashboards to track key performance indicators (KPIs) and generate actionable insights.
3. Technical and Integration Capabilities
A CRM does not operate in a vacuum. Its ability to integrate with your existing technology stack is paramount for creating a unified data ecosystem and avoiding information silos.
- API Access: A well-documented RESTful API is crucial for custom development and connecting with proprietary in-house systems.
- Native Integrations: Check for pre-built integrations with essential tools like email clients (Google Workspace, Microsoft 365), marketing platforms (Mailchimp, HubSpot), accounting software (QuickBooks, Xero), and ERP systems.
- Data Security & Compliance: Verify the vendor's security protocols, including data encryption (at rest and in transit), role-based access controls, and compliance with regulations like GDPR, CCPA, or HIPAA if applicable.
4. Usability, Adoption, and Scalability
The most feature-rich CRM is useless if your team finds it difficult to use. Focus on user experience and the platform's ability to grow with your company.
- User Interface (UI/UX): During demos and trials, evaluate the intuitiveness of the interface. Is it clean, easy to navigate, and responsive?
- Mobile Accessibility: A functional and feature-complete mobile application is essential for field sales and remote teams.
- Customization: Can you easily add custom fields, modify layouts, and build custom workflows without extensive technical knowledge?
- Scalability: Review the different pricing tiers. Does the vendor offer a clear path for growth that allows you to add users and features as your business expands?
5. Final Evaluation and Selection
Conclude your review with a structured final assessment. Use a scoring matrix to quantitatively compare your shortlisted vendors against your predefined requirements. Always conduct free trials and request live, personalized demonstrations with your key stakeholders to validate your findings before making a final purchasing decision.